    We've been to Silver Dollar City 4 times now and here's what I've learned…read more... get there 40 minutes before opening on a Sunday. No one will be there. Park in the free parking lot as close as you can get! Bring a small fanny pack with you, they won't check it. You'll get to do the pledge of allegiance & national anthem & the park will open. Make sure that while they're doing the POA & NA that you're sitting at the gate by time traveler. After that, do the time traveler and start making your rounds to all the other big rides before the heat. By this time it will be noon or close to it. Get a sweet treat & water, sit & relax, go see a show. Once you're done if you're done for the day, head out and stop by the taffy store & cinnamon rolls (SO good & worth the money for real). Then head to your favorite fast food restaurant at like 1-2 pm. Then you have time to get back to your room, shower, nap, and get ready for dinner! It's honestly perfect. I took a star off though because every time I'm at silver dollar city, powder keg is down. This time- powder keg, outlaw run, and fire in the hole were all down... so we went to the park to only ride Wildfire & Time Traveler twice plus the barn swing. It's hard because the park really isn't that big for thrill seekers.... you have your main big rides but if 2 of them are down it really stinks. They weren't just down for maintenance for a little bit and re-opened.... They were down for 2 full days which now makes me a little nervous I do love how much they love & respect America & veterans. The water refill stations are very nice. AC in all of the stores is a major win!

    Silver Dollar City was an awesome experience. We had a two day pass, and used it all. Be prepared…read moreto walk up and down hills. Stay hydrated throughout your visit. It was super hot. The park offered free water and ice at all venues that sold food or drinks. The park staff was super friendly and well trained. This place is massive and we needed 2 days to do everything we wanted to do. There is free parking, and a shuttle to get you from the parking lot to the park. We were able to bring in lunch, snacks, and drinks. We rented a double stroller at a cost of $28 which worked well for our 3 year old and our food and drink's containers. There are rides and activities for all ages. We really enjoyed the train ride, and the interactions during that ride. If you are elderly you may want to consider renting a motorized assistance device to make your park experience more enjoyable. Getting in to and out of the parking lot was a breeze. You may want to consider a family photo to commemorate your visit. All in all there was fun had by all.

    Hey Yelpers! Our month long journey brought us here for a few nights. Reservation and check in…read moreprocess was super easy. The office staff are very friendly and informative. Being the week of 4th of July (US Independence Day) there were different events going on in the campground and around the area. They had a site decorating contest, BBQ, and other things on the 4th itself. As for the campground, it was very clean and well organized. Two different shower rooms were available. I would recommend the one by the laundry room. The other smells like it is located over the septic tank. All that waste has to go somewhere, so I didn't take stars for it. Besides, both shower areas were the cleanest I've seen in a campground this trip. One big drawback was the location of the septic drain for our site. It was at the very end of the site on the uphill side. I have a tube incline accordion thing to help with the distance but it couldn't beat the slope difference. I had to manually lift my septic drain tube to force it down after the initial pressure subsided. That wasn't fun. As far as location, it's in a good spot just close enough to the entertainment and shopping. If you want to be close to either of the lakes, you are a ways away. Overall, would I stay here again, yes. The campground has a lot of great things going for it. Check them out and see for yourself!
